Definition

Sassy means lively, bold, and full of spirit. It describes someone who is confident and a little bit cheeky.

Usage note

Sassy often implies a playful or spirited impertinence, particularly in younger people or in informal contexts. It can sometimes carry a negative connotation of rudeness if not used carefully.
